The Interview Experience is a score from 1 star (very negative) to 5 stars (very positive) generated based on the Interview Insights at this company.

The number you see in the middle of the doughnut pie chart is the simple average of these scores. If you hover over the various sections of the donut, you will see the % breakdown of each score given.

The percentile score in the title is calculated across the entire Company Database and uses an adjusted score based on Bayesian Estimates (to account for companies that have few interview insights). Simply put, as a company gets more reviews, the confidence of a "true score" increases so it is pulled closer to its simple average and away from the average of the entire dataset.

Interview
Quick phone call to make sure I was competent (modeling/finance/industry questions). Next I met with a MD and head of group 1 on 1 and it was more of an informal discussion about background and if I would be a good fit. Knew me well from a competitor so nothing too grueling or challenging. More of discussion since they knew me already.
